Let's talk about the phone closest to you. Under the leadership of Samsung and Apple, high-end mobile phones now basically use OLED screens, or AMOLED screens. The OLED on the mobile phone is closer to the OLED paper technology in our cognition, and the RGB three-color pixels are self-illuminating, forming a display effect. However, in fact, due to the influence of materials and other aspects, the life of the three seed pixels of red, green and blue is different, to be precise, the life of the blue subpixel is the shortest, followed by red, and the human eye is the most sensitive to green, so the green subpixel has the longest life. If OLED arranges subpixels uniformly like a liquid crystal, problems such as color casts and uneven display will occur after a period of use. Therefore, in fact, the OLED pixel arrangement of the mobile phone needs a special arrangement, increasing the display area of red and blue subpixels, so that they can reduce their luminous brightness and increase the service life of the OLED panel.

The technology represented by SuperAMOLED makes the three primary color sub-pixels diamond-shaped arrangement, and through the universal sub-pixel technology, a green subpixel serves the red and blue sub-pixels on both sides at the same time, realizing the effect of continuing the life of the panel.

However, the common subpixel technology has caused pixel loss problems, the drill row OLED panel is attenuated by about one-third compared to the actual resolution of the RGB panel, the sharpness will also be discounted, in addition, due to the shape of the diamond arrangement, the oblique lines can not use three colors, so the phenomenon of color edges will occur.

It is worth mentioning that SuperAMOLED is Samsung's patented technology, domestic panel manufacturers have also explored technologies such as Delta arrangement in recent years, but because the pixel loss is more serious than the diamond arrangement, the clarity is not high, it is jokingly called "Zhou Dongyu arrangement", and now domestic manufacturers basically use similar diamond arrangement technology, Zhou Dongyu has been gradually eliminated.

The OLED panel on the mobile phone is certainly more mature, but the problem of resolution loss makes the TV set more sensitive to resolution, and even the need for point-to-point display products are not very suitable. Therefore, OLED TVs use a technology commonly known as WOLED.

In principle, WOLED is actually closer to a self-illuminating LCD TV. The W of WOLED refers to the fact that the TV uses the OLED panel as a backlight, so that the OLED uniformly emits white light (or yellow light, etc.), and then displays red, green and blue tricolor imaging through the polarizer. OLED TVs do not have color casts and "rag screen" issues caused by different subpixel lifetimes.

In addition, television sets have high requirements for brightness, and video formats such as HDR require the peak brightness of the TV to reach at least 1000 nits or more. WOLED technology increases the brightness of the picture by adding white subpixels in addition to RGB. It should be noted that although white sub-pixels are also added, compared with the RGBW LCD TVs that were popular in previous years, WOLED TVs are still 4K point-to-point display panels, so they are not fake 4K TVs.

WOLED has a longer lifespan, but its technical characteristics of opening white subpixels in high-brightness screens will "dilute" the color of the TV, especially in bright and vivid scenes, the color performance is not satisfactory.

In order to solve the problem of color attenuation under the high brightness of WOLED TV, QD-OLED technology came into being. As the name suggests, QD-OLED integrates the technical characteristics of quantum dots (QuantumDot) and OLED, replaces the polarizer with photo-induced quantum dot materials, allows OLED to display color in synergy with quantum dots, QD-OLED not only increases brightness, but also effectively uses the ultra-high color rendering of quantum dot technology, according to tests, QD-OLED can reach 90% of the BT.2020 color gamut, breaking the color gamut record of the active display panel.

In addition, QD-OLED technology is based on RGB three-color display, without white sub-pixel interference, which eliminates the problem of color attenuation. On the whole, QD-OLED is the display technology with the highest picture quality potential at this stage, and this year Sony and Samsung have also launched their own QD-OLED TVs, which are the best choice for TV enthusiasts.

In addition to the TV field, Samsung has also extended the tentacles of QD-OLED to medium-sized display panels such as monitors, and jointly launched an alien-branded QD-OLED display with Dell. QD-OLED displays have a slightly different pixel arrangement than TVs, but the technical principles are much the same. Although QD-OLED can achieve a fairly high level of image quality expression, there are still some problems with QD-OLED at this stage. For example, although the subpixel arrangement of the triangle does not have the problem of resolution loss, it will form a color edge at the edge of the image, which is especially obvious for displays with more scenes such as display windows and text, in addition, the QD-OLED structure is simple, and the ambient light is not blocked by the polarizer, which will reverse excite the quantum dot material and pollute the picture. Therefore, QD-OLED is not very suitable for scenes with direct light hitting the screen.

It is worth mentioning that the WOLED panel is currently the exclusive supply of LGDisplay, while the QD-OLED is temporarily monopolized by Samsung, and the OLED TV is actually a competition between two Korean companies. From a technical point of view, QD-OLED uses printed technology, which is theoretically cheaper than WOLED's evaporation technology, but because WOLED technology started early, it has been quite large in OLED TVs, and the current price of WOLED, which occupies a large-scale industrial advantage, is far lower than QD-OLED, and even lower than some high-end Mini-LED TVs.

In addition to QD-OLED, JOLED launched OLED panel is also manufactured using a printed process, has launched several 27-inch display products, using standard RGB pixel arrangement, so peak brightness and other hard parameters are not as good as QD-OLED panel, but standard RGB for professional display, especially the display is very suitable. At present, this panel is listed not long ago, the price is still relatively high, using the panel Philips 27E1N8900 price is about 5500 yuan.

As a special display, the notebook screen is also more special in terms of requirements. The need for actual resolution makes it impossible to arrange the diamonds, so the OLED on the notebook uses a special RGB arrangement scheme. The Nintendo SwitchOLED edition also uses this OLED arrangement scheme. Except for the absence of common subpixel problems, the arrangement of diamonds is much the same, and I will not repeat them here.
